Actor Martin Compston has been given odds of 50/1 to become the next James Bond, joining fellow Scottish thespians including Richard Madden and Sam Heughan on a bookies’ list of potential names to fill the iconic role. Mr Compston, the Greenock-born Line of Duty star, has been given the quote by betting firm Skybet after being tipped by fans to take over from Daniel Craig.

International Scottish Gin Day (Saturday, October 2) is a special day to enjoy all things Scottish gin. Thousands of gin fans, experts, beginners and producers will come together to celebrate all across the world, with the focus being on Scotland's fastest growing spirit.
